The world of online gambling is constantly evolving, with new and exciting games emerging regularly. Among these, the crash casino game has rapidly gained popularity due to its simple yet thrilling gameplay. It's a unique experience that blends elements of skill and chance, offering players the potential for substantial rewards while simultaneously presenting a significant risk. This game captures the attention of seasoned gamblers and newcomers alike, offering a fast-paced and visually engaging way to test one's nerves and strategic thinking.

The core mechanic is straightforward: a multiplier begins to increase from 1x, and players place a bet with the hope of cashing out before the multiplier “crashes.” The longer the multiplier climbs, the greater the potential payout. However, the crash can occur at any moment, resulting in a loss of the initial bet. This constant tension and the need for quick decision-making are what make this game so appealing. Understanding the underlying principles and developing a strategic approach can significantly improve a player’s odds of success in this increasingly popular online casino offering.

Developing Effective Betting Strategies

Numerous betting strategies can be employed in a crash casino game, ranging from conservative to aggressive approaches. A common strategy is the "martingale" system, where the player doubles their bet after each loss, with the goal of recovering all previous losses plus a small profit. While this strategy can be effective in the short term, it requires a substantial bankroll and carries a significant risk of reaching the table’s maximum bet limit. Another approach is to set pre-determined profit targets and stop-loss limits. This helps to manage risk and prevents emotional decision-making. Determining the optimal strategy is a personal choice and depends on individual risk tolerance and financial resources.

Risk Management and Bankroll Control

Effective risk management and bankroll control are essential for long-term success in any form of gambling, and the crash casino game is no exception. A common mistake is betting a large percentage of your bankroll on a single round, which can quickly lead to significant losses. A more prudent approach is to allocate a small percentage of your bankroll to each bet, typically between 1% and 5%. This strategy helps to cushion against losing streaks and allows you to stay in the game for a longer period. It’s also important to have a separate bankroll specifically for gambling and to avoid using funds intended for essential expenses.

Understanding Volatility

Volatility refers to the degree of fluctuation in potential payouts. Games with high volatility offer the potential for large wins but also carry a greater risk of losses. Crash casino games generally exhibit high volatility due to the unpredictable nature of the crash. Understanding this inherent volatility is crucial for managing expectations and avoiding impulsive decisions. Acknowledge that losing streaks are a normal part of the game and avoid increasing your bets in an attempt to quickly recover losses. Patience and discipline are key to navigating the volatile nature of this style of gaming.

The Future of Crash Gaming: Innovations and Trends

The crash casino game continues to evolve, with new features and innovations constantly being introduced. Social features, such as chat rooms and leaderboards, are becoming increasingly common, enhancing the interactive element of the game. Provably fair technology, which allows players to verify the randomness of each round, is also gaining traction, increasing transparency and building trust. Furthermore, we are witnessing the integration of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) technologies, offering players a more immersive and engaging gaming experience.
